01What it is & why it works
Meta (Facebook + Instagram) is where Bangkok's expat community actually lives day to day. Foreign renters join area and city housing groups, scroll Marketplace, and discover listings through Reels long before they think to search a portal. Unlike Google, Meta creates demand — you put a beautiful unit in front of someone who wasn't actively looking and spark the move. It rewards fast responses, real photos and video, and showing up where the community already gathers.
02Why it works for Thailand rentals
- Bangkok expat housing groups are huge, high-intent and free to post in — renters ask for exactly what you have every day
- Marketplace is built for housing and surfaces listings to local + expat searchers at no cost
- Reels and Stories give short-form property video enormous organic reach when the first 2 seconds hook
- Meta ads have unmatched targeting — by location, language, expat/relocation interests and lookalikes of past enquirers
03How to set it up
1. Set up a business Facebook Page + linked Instagram professional account (not a personal profile) so you get insights and can run ads
2. Create a Meta Business Suite account and a Pixel/Conversions API on your site to track enquiries and build audiences
3. Join the major Bangkok expat and area-specific housing groups; read each group's posting rules before you post
4. Build a simple content kit: 8–12 photos per unit, one 15–30s walkthrough video, price, area, BTS/MRT distance, and a LINE/enquiry link

04The playbook — tactics that convert
- Lead every post with the deal in line one: price + area + BTS ("฿35k · Asoke · BTS 3 min · pet friendly") — people skim
- Post vertical walkthrough Reels; the first 2 seconds must show the best room or the view, not a logo
- Reply within minutes — speed wins on Facebook; set saved replies for price, availability and viewing
- Run a retargeting ad to people who watched 50%+ of a walkthrough or visited a listing but didn't enquire
- Build a lookalike audience from past enquirers, and a separate audience for relocation/DTV/LTR interests
05Mistakes to avoid
Don’t do this…
- Spamming the same listing across every group — admins ban you; tailor and space out posts and follow group rules
- Posting from a personal profile, so you get no insights, no ads, and no retargeting
- Slow replies — a lead that waits an hour has usually already messaged three other people
- Stock or over-edited photos that don't match reality; Meta audiences punish low-trust visuals
- Boosting a post with no Pixel and no audience strategy — you pay for vanity reach, not enquiries
06What it costs
Organic posting in groups, on Marketplace and on your Page is free. Meta ads in Thailand can deliver enquiries from roughly ฿100–400 each depending on creative and targeting; a ฿200–500/day test for a week is enough to find a winning audience and creative before scaling. Strong video creative is the biggest lever on cost — better than more budget.
07Frequently asked
Groups or ads — where should I start?Start free: post good photos and a short walkthrough in the right Bangkok housing groups and on Marketplace, and reply fast. Once you see which units and messages get traction, put paid budget behind the winners.
What performs best on Meta right now?Vertical short-form video — a clean 15–30 second walkthrough that opens on the best room or view, with price and area on screen. It out-reaches static photos for both organic Reels and paid.
Is Facebook Marketplace allowed for rentals in Thailand?Yes, property rentals are a supported Marketplace category. Post with clear photos, an accurate price, the area and a LINE contact, and refresh periodically to stay visible.
